在当今技术迅速发展的背景下,k8(Kubernetes的简称)已成为云计算和容器管理领域的重要工具。作为一个开源的平台,k8提供了一种自动化方式来部署、扩展以及管理应用程序容器,使得微服务架构的实现变得更加高效和灵活。
k8的核心意义在于其对容器化应用的编排与管理。它允许开发者在不同的云环境中轻松地部署和管理成千上万的容器,无论是私有云、公有云还是混合云,k8都能够提供一致的操作体验。这种跨平台的兼容性使得企业在选择云服务时更加灵活。

k8的应用场景非常广泛。通过使用k8,企业能够实现快速的应用部署和恢复,降低开发和运营的复杂性。其自我修复功能确保了系统在出现故障时能够快速恢复,提升了系统的可靠性。 k8支持横向扩展,可以根据负载自动调整应用的实例数量,从而优化资源的使用。
在k8的运作中,有几个关键概念需要了解。首先是“节点”(Node),即运行容器的机器。再者是“Pod”,这是k8中部署的最小单位,通常包含一个或多个容器。 k8的“服务”(Service)概念则用于定义如何访问和连接这些Pod,为外部流量和内部通信提供了有效的解决方案。
k8不仅是一个技术工具,更是推动云原生架构的关键力量。了解k8及其背后的意义和应用,将帮助你在现代软件开发中走在前沿,同时也能加强你的团队在数字化转型中的竞争力。如果你有兴趣深入了解k8的技术细节,加入相关社区或参与在线课程,将是一个不错的选择。
感兴趣的伙伴可以在下方添加一下,也是为了大家有个属于纯爱好者的、纯净的平台来交流沟通、入圈、寻找自己的partner,少走弯路、少踩坑,毕竟鱼龙混杂、知己难觅~
(备用微信号: domsm789 )









